Frequently asked questions
-
A GSM intercom uses mobile networks (SIM cards) to enable wireless communication between visitors and property owners, without needing WiFi or landlines.
-
No, they operate over the mobile network, removing the need for broadband or hardwired connections.
-
Yes, many GSM intercoms allow remote access via app or web dashboard to open gates or doors from anywhere.
-
Not at all. GSM intercoms are quick to install and ideal for locations where cabling is difficult or costly.
-
A strong signal is recommended for optimal performance. In low-signal areas, an external antenna can often resolve issues.
-
Yes. They include features like PIN entry, call filtering, and encrypted access controls to ensure secure entry management.
-
Most GSM intercoms are compatible with standard electric locks, gates, and door controllers.
